
Safari如何查看网页源码:启用开发者模式、使用快捷键、右键查看源代码、查看元素面板。启用开发者模式是最基础的一步,接下来就可以通过快捷键、右键或者查看元素面板来深入解析网页源码。详细描述一下“启用开发者模式”:在Safari浏览器中,查看网页源码的第一步是启用开发者模式。打开Safari浏览器,选择屏幕左上角的“Safari”菜单,点击“偏好设置”,然后在弹出的窗口中选择“高级”标签。勾选“在菜单栏中显示‘开发’菜单”选项。完成这些步骤后,你会在菜单栏中看到一个新的“开发”选项,点击它即可开始查看网页源码。
一、启用开发者模式
启用开发者模式是查看网页源码的基础步骤。Safari浏览器默认情况下不显示开发者工具,因此需要手动启用。
步骤一:打开偏好设置
在Safari浏览器中,点击屏幕左上角的“Safari”菜单,然后选择“偏好设置”。这将打开一个设置窗口。
步骤二:选择高级标签
在偏好设置窗口中,点击“高级”标签。这个标签页包含了许多高级设置选项。
步骤三:启用开发者菜单
在高级标签页中,勾选“在菜单栏中显示‘开发’菜单”选项。这会在Safari的菜单栏中添加一个新的“开发”菜单。通过这一菜单,你可以访问各种开发工具,包括查看网页源码的功能。
二、使用快捷键查看网页源码
快捷键是快速查看网页源码的一种高效方式。通过快捷键可以迅速打开开发者工具,并立即查看网页的HTML、CSS和JavaScript代码。
快捷键组合
在启用了开发者模式后,你可以使用快捷键“Option + Command + U”来查看网页源码。这个快捷键会立即打开一个新的窗口,显示当前网页的HTML源码。
快捷键的优势
使用快捷键查看源码的优势在于快捷和方便。对于需要频繁查看源码的开发者来说,快捷键可以大大提高工作效率。此外,通过快捷键打开的源码窗口还提供了代码高亮和折叠功能,便于阅读和分析。
三、右键查看源代码
右键查看源代码是另一种查看网页源码的常用方法。这个方法适用于不熟悉快捷键或者喜欢使用鼠标操作的用户。
右键菜单选项
在启用了开发者模式后,右键点击网页的任意空白处,会在弹出的右键菜单中看到“查看网页源代码”选项。点击这个选项,Safari会打开一个新的窗口,显示当前网页的HTML源码。
右键查看的便利性
使用右键查看源代码的便利性在于操作简单,无需记住快捷键。对于一些临时查看或者不频繁查看源码的用户来说,这种方法更加直观和易用。
四、查看元素面板
查看元素面板是分析网页结构和样式的高级功能。通过元素面板,你可以查看和编辑网页的HTML和CSS,还可以调试JavaScript代码。
打开元素面板
在启用了开发者模式后,点击菜单栏中的“开发”菜单,选择“显示网页检查器”选项。或者,你可以使用快捷键“Option + Command + I”直接打开元素面板。
使用元素面板
元素面板分为多个标签页,包括“元素”、“控制台”、“网络”、“源代码”等。通过“元素”标签页,你可以实时查看和编辑网页的HTML和CSS。点击某个元素,会在右侧显示该元素的详细信息,包括样式、盒模型、事件监听等。你可以直接在面板中修改这些属性,实时查看效果。
五、深入解析网页源码
查看网页源码不仅仅是简单的查看,还需要深入解析和理解。通过开发者工具,你可以了解网页的结构、样式和行为,甚至可以发现潜在的问题和优化点。
分析HTML结构
HTML是网页的骨架,理解HTML结构是解析网页源码的第一步。通过查看HTML源码,你可以了解网页的层次结构、元素的嵌套关系以及每个元素的属性和内容。这有助于你快速找到需要修改或分析的部分。
分析CSS样式
CSS是网页的外观,理解CSS样式是解析网页源码的关键。通过元素面板,你可以查看每个元素的样式规则,包括继承的样式、计算后的样式以及未应用的样式。你还可以直接在面板中修改样式,实时查看效果。这对于调试和优化样式非常有用。
调试JavaScript代码
JavaScript是网页的行为,调试JavaScript代码是解析网页源码的高级技能。通过控制台和源代码标签页,你可以查看和调试JavaScript代码。你可以设置断点、查看变量值、执行代码片段等。这有助于你发现和解决JavaScript代码中的问题。
六、使用开发者工具的高级功能
Safari的开发者工具不仅仅是查看网页源码,还提供了许多高级功能,帮助你更深入地解析和优化网页。
性能分析
通过网络和时间线标签页,你可以分析网页的加载性能和运行性能。你可以查看每个资源的加载时间、脚本的执行时间、帧率等。这有助于你发现性能瓶颈,并采取相应的优化措施。
移动设备模拟
通过设备模式,你可以模拟不同的移动设备,查看网页在不同屏幕尺寸和分辨率下的显示效果。你可以选择预定义的设备,也可以自定义设备参数。这有助于你优化网页的响应式设计。
安全检查
通过安全标签页,你可以检查网页的安全性,包括HTTPS证书、混合内容、内容安全策略等。这有助于你发现和解决潜在的安全问题,提升网页的安全性。
七、常见问题及解决方法
在查看和解析网页源码的过程中,可能会遇到一些常见问题。以下是一些常见问题及其解决方法。
无法启用开发者模式
如果在偏好设置中找不到“在菜单栏中显示‘开发’菜单”选项,可能是因为Safari版本过低。建议升级到最新版本的Safari,并确保操作系统也是最新版本。
无法查看源码
如果使用快捷键或右键菜单无法打开源码窗口,可能是因为网页禁用了右键菜单或者快捷键被其他应用占用。可以尝试通过开发菜单打开网页检查器,然后切换到“源代码”标签页查看源码。
无法调试JavaScript代码
如果在控制台或源代码标签页中无法调试JavaScript代码,可能是因为网页启用了代码混淆或压缩。可以尝试使用断点调试或者在本地环境中调试未压缩的代码。
八、优化网页源码的技巧
查看和解析网页源码不仅仅是为了了解网页的结构和样式,更重要的是优化网页的性能和用户体验。以下是一些优化网页源码的技巧。
优化HTML结构
简化HTML结构,减少不必要的嵌套和标签。使用语义化标签,提高网页的可读性和可维护性。通过合理使用标签和属性,可以提高网页的加载速度和搜索引擎优化效果。
优化CSS样式
合并和压缩CSS文件,减少HTTP请求和文件大小。使用CSS预处理器,如Sass或Less,提高样式的可维护性和复用性。通过合理使用选择器和样式规则,可以提高样式的性能和兼容性。
优化JavaScript代码
合并和压缩JavaScript文件,减少HTTP请求和文件大小。使用模块化和异步加载,提高代码的可维护性和执行效率。通过合理使用事件监听和回调函数,可以提高代码的性能和响应速度。
优化资源加载
使用CDN加速静态资源的加载,减少服务器压力和用户等待时间。通过懒加载和预加载技术,可以提高网页的加载速度和用户体验。优化图片和视频的格式和大小,减少资源的加载时间和带宽消耗。
九、使用项目管理工具提升开发效率
在团队开发中,使用项目管理工具可以大大提升开发效率和协作效果。推荐使用“研发项目管理系统PingCode”和“通用项目协作软件Worktile”。
研发项目管理系统PingCode
PingCode是专为研发团队设计的项目管理系统,提供了需求管理、任务管理、版本管理、测试管理等功能。通过PingCode,你可以轻松管理项目的各个环节,提高开发效率和质量。
通用项目协作软件Worktile
Worktile是一款通用的项目协作软件,适用于各种类型的团队和项目。它提供了任务管理、文档管理、日程管理等功能。通过Worktile,你可以轻松协作和沟通,提升团队的协作效率和项目的执行力。
十、总结
通过Safari浏览器的开发者工具,可以轻松查看和解析网页源码。启用开发者模式、使用快捷键、右键查看源代码和查看元素面板是常用的方法。深入解析网页源码,可以帮助你了解网页的结构、样式和行为,发现和解决潜在的问题。同时,通过优化网页源码和使用项目管理工具,可以提升网页的性能和用户体验,提高开发效率和协作效果。
相关问答FAQs:
1. 如何在Safari中打开网页源码?
要在Safari中查看网页源码,您可以按照以下步骤操作:
- 首先,打开Safari浏览器并导航到您想要查看源码的网页。
- 其次,点击浏览器菜单栏中的“开发”选项。
- 在下拉菜单中,选择“显示网页源代码”选项。
- 这将在浏览器窗口的底部打开一个新的窗口,其中包含网页的源代码。
2. 如何在Safari中查找特定的代码段?
如果您希望在网页源码中查找特定的代码段,可以按照以下步骤进行:
- 首先,打开Safari浏览器并导航到您想要查找代码的网页。
- 其次,点击浏览器菜单栏中的“编辑”选项。
- 在下拉菜单中,选择“在页面中查找”选项。
- 这将在浏览器窗口的顶部打开一个搜索框。在该搜索框中输入您想要查找的代码关键词,并按下回车键。
- Safari将会高亮显示所有匹配的代码段,便于您查看和分析。
3. 如何在Safari中保存网页源码?
如果您想将网页源码保存到本地计算机上,可以按照以下步骤操作:
- 首先,打开Safari浏览器并导航到您想要保存源码的网页。
- 其次,点击浏览器菜单栏中的“文件”选项。
- 在下拉菜单中,选择“另存为”选项。
- 这将打开一个保存对话框,您可以在其中选择保存源码的位置和文件名。
- 选择保存的位置和文件名后,点击“保存”按钮即可将网页源码保存到本地计算机上。
文章包含AI辅助创作,作者:Edit1,如若转载,请注明出处:https://docs.pingcode.com/baike/2843958